Specific majors offered
40 specific majors with reported completions. Earnings shown are median annual earnings 1 year after graduation; debt is median student-loan debt at graduation.
| Major | Credential | Grads | Median earnings | Median debt |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Registered Nursing, Nursing Administration, Nursing Research and Clinical Nursing. | Associate's | 152 | $58,266 | $30,500 |
| Business Operations Support and Assistant Services. | Undergraduate certificate | 45 | — | $16,722 |
| Registered Nursing, Nursing Administration, Nursing Research and Clinical Nursing. | Bachelor's | 41 | $66,327 | $39,232 |
| Health and Medical Administrative Services. | Undergraduate certificate | 38 | $28,134 | $13,143 |
| Allied Health and Medical Assisting Services. | Undergraduate certificate | 37 | $27,622 | $14,042 |
| Teacher Education and Professional Development, Specific Levels and Methods. | Undergraduate certificate | 36 | $23,212 | $12,358 |
| Health Services/Allied Health/Health Sciences, General. | Associate's | 24 | — | — |
| Business Administration, Management and Operations. | Associate's | 19 | $42,729 | $25,555 |
| Teacher Education and Professional Development, Specific Levels and Methods. | Associate's | 16 | $27,199 | $23,086 |
| Allied Health and Medical Assisting Services. | Associate's | 16 | $29,867 | $26,612 |
| Human Services, General. | Associate's | 14 | $23,880 | $26,882 |
| Human Resources Management and Services. | Associate's | 12 | $39,860 | $26,536 |
| Design and Applied Arts. | Associate's | 9 | — | $28,722 |
| Accounting and Related Services. | Undergraduate certificate | 9 | — | $13,047 |
| Criminal Justice and Corrections. | Associate's | 8 | $38,053 | $24,408 |
| Business Administration, Management and Operations. | Master's | 8 | — | — |
| Accounting and Related Services. | Associate's | 8 | $38,663 | $23,823 |
| Health and Medical Administrative Services. | Associate's | 6 | $34,472 | $26,000 |
| Legal Support Services. | Undergraduate certificate | 4 | — | $28,796 |
| Marketing. | Associate's | 4 | $44,129 | $27,167 |
| Computer/Information Technology Administration and Management. | Associate's | 3 | — | $21,480 |
| Legal Support Services. | Associate's | 3 | $33,299 | $27,876 |
| Design and Applied Arts. | Bachelor's | 3 | — | $35,438 |
| Health Services/Allied Health/Health Sciences, General. | Undergraduate certificate | 2 | — | $13,833 |
| Management Information Systems and Services. | Associate's | 2 | $39,540 | $27,387 |
| Computer Engineering. | Associate's | 1 | $49,653 | $23,635 |
| Information Science/Studies. | Bachelor's | — | — | $22,632 |
| Computer Science. | Bachelor's | — | $56,886 | $38,409 |
| Computer/Information Technology Administration and Management. | Bachelor's | — | $52,103 | $47,579 |
| Educational Administration and Supervision. | Bachelor's | — | $32,516 | $35,697 |
| Criminal Justice and Corrections. | Bachelor's | — | $39,439 | $42,037 |
| Human Services, General. | Bachelor's | — | — | $46,312 |
| Health and Medical Administrative Services. | Bachelor's | — | $42,125 | $44,359 |
| Allied Health Diagnostic, Intervention, and Treatment Professions. | Associate's | — | $47,657 | $25,000 |
| Clinical/Medical Laboratory Science/Research and Allied Professions. | Associate's | — | $40,841 | $27,535 |
| Public Health. | Bachelor's | — | $31,854 | $40,809 |
| Practical Nursing, Vocational Nursing and Nursing Assistants. | Undergraduate certificate | — | $40,180 | $21,274 |
| Business Administration, Management and Operations. | Bachelor's | — | $49,340 | $37,315 |
| Accounting and Related Services. | Bachelor's | — | $47,670 | $39,938 |
| Finance and Financial Management Services. | Bachelor's | — | $48,056 | $31,000 |
Source: U.S. Department of Education, College Scorecard Field of Study. Earnings cover graduates who received federal financial aid and are working / not enrolled. Cells marked "—" are not reported or were suppressed for privacy.
About Rasmussen University-Wisconsin
Rasmussen University-Wisconsin is a small institution located in Green Bay, Wisconsin, primarily awarding the associate degree. It enrolls roughly 55 undergraduate students in a city setting. The most popular fields of study include Health professions, Business, Education.
Cost & tuition
Published net-price data for Rasmussen University-Wisconsin is not available in the most recent federal release.
Graduation & earnings outcomes
The 6-year graduation rate is 56.7%, a above-average completion outcome. 100.0% of first-time students return for a second year, a useful proxy for student satisfaction and academic fit. Ten years after enrolling, the median graduate earns $39,080 per year according to U.S. Department of Education earnings tracking.
Programs & majors
Rasmussen University-Wisconsin confers degrees and certificates across 7 broad program areas, with the largest concentrations of completions in Health professions, Business, Education. Grouped into wider academic categories, the mix is led by health (71% of credentials), business (14% of credentials), social sciences (10% of credentials), which gives a quick read on the school's overall academic profile.
